sneak 402c0797d5 Initial implementation of hdmistat - Linux framebuffer system stats display
Features:
- Beautiful system statistics display using IBM Plex Mono font
- Direct framebuffer rendering without X11/Wayland
- Multiple screens with automatic carousel rotation
- Real-time system monitoring (CPU, memory, disk, network, processes)
- Systemd service integration with install command
- Clean architecture using uber/fx dependency injection

Architecture:
- Cobra CLI with daemon, install, status, and info commands
- Modular design with separate packages for display, rendering, and stats
- Font embedding for zero runtime dependencies
- Layout API for clean text rendering
- Support for multiple screen types (overview, top CPU, top memory)

Technical details:
- Uses gopsutil for cross-platform system stats collection
- Direct Linux framebuffer access via memory mapping
- Anti-aliased text rendering with freetype
- Configurable screen rotation and update intervals
- Structured logging with slog
- Comprehensive test coverage and linting setup

This initial version provides a solid foundation for displaying rich
system information on resource-constrained devices like Raspberry Pis.

hdmistat

A beautiful system statistics display daemon for Linux framebuffers. Perfect for Raspberry Pis and other headless systems.

Features

  • 🖥️ Direct framebuffer rendering (no X11/Wayland required)
  • 📊 Real-time system statistics (CPU, memory, disk, network)
  • 🎨 Beautiful typography using IBM Plex Mono
  • 🔄 Configurable screen carousel
  • 🚀 Lightweight and efficient
  • 🔧 Easy systemd integration

Installation

go install git.eeqj.de/sneak/hdmistat/cmd/hdmistat@latest
sudo hdmistat install

Usage

Run as daemon

sudo hdmistat daemon

Install systemd service

sudo hdmistat install

Check status

hdmistat status

Display system info

hdmistat info

Configuration

Create /etc/hdmistat/config.yaml:

framebuffer: /dev/fb0
rotation_interval: 10s
screens:
  - overview
  - top_cpu
  - top_memory
  - network_detail

Building from Source

git clone https://git.eeqj.de/sneak/hdmistat
cd hdmistat
make build

Requirements

  • Linux with framebuffer support
  • Go 1.21+
  • Root access for framebuffer device
